These are the only scents recommended by the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service to repel snakes. WebApr 13, 2024 · Run soapy water over the bite. Take off anything that might constrict your blood flow as the affected limb swells such as bracelets or rings. Keep the bite below the level of your heart and keep the limb immobile to slow the venom’s spread. Do not apply a tourniquet, make incisions over the bite, or apply ice.

Body … gossip bakery glenda sully page 8WebRattlesnakes are highly specialized, venomous reptiles with large bodies and triangle-shaped heads. They are one of the most iconic groups of North American snakes due to the characteristic “rattle” found at the tip of the tail. The rattle is composed of a series of interlocking scales, which the snake adds to each time it molts. chief logistics specialistWebApr 6, 2024 · No, black snakes do not eat rattlesnakes.
